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Cut the spaghetti squash in half lengthwise and scoop out the seeds.
- Drizzle olive oil on the insides and sprinkle with salt and pepper.
- Place the squash halves cut-side down on a baking sheet and bake for 30-40 minutes until tender.
Assembly
- Once cooled, use a fork to scrape out the spaghetti-like strands.
- In a baking dish, mix the squash strands with the homemade Alfredo sauce.
- Top with shredded cheese and bake at 375°F (190°C) for about 20 minutes until bubbly and golden.
Serving
- Serve warm and enjoy the celebration of flavors.

Notes
For storage, cool the dish completely, transfer to an airtight container, and store in the fridge for 3-5 days. Can be frozen, though the texture may alter.
